Simulated selves in a simulated world
The world we think we live in is but a projected tiling of our own concepts onto the scaffolding of external reality, and our personal selves mere illusions, argues Felix Haas. But does this essay go far enough in addressing the very doubts it raises? Does it consistently and consequently pursue its own premises and conclusions to their ultimate implications?
